Tosh.0 - Season 6
Series Details

Title: Tosh.0

Overview: A weekly topical series hosted by comedian Daniel Tosh that delves into all aspects of the Internet, from the ingenious to the absurd to the medically inadvisable.

  • Tosh.0 - We Buy Golf (Season 6 - Episode 1)

    Daniel brings back Sports or Consequences; clears up the mystery of who his father is; the sexiest Web redemption ever.

    Tosh.0 - Ice JJ Fish (Season 6 - Episode 2)

    Daniel takes girl out on a date; Daniel gives his car away; singer Ice JJ Fish gets a Web redemption.

    Tosh.0 - Take No Orders (Season 6 - Episode 3)

    Daniel attempts to turn every home in America into a public restroom; plays a game the censors will hate; a guy who doesn't take direction from women gets a Web redemption.

    Tosh.0 - Ben's Video Resume (Season 6 - Episode 4)

    Daniel speaks to Congress and has lunch with a homeless man; a child forced to enter the workforce gets a Web redemption.

    Tosh.0 - Boomer the Dog (Season 6 - Episode 5)

    Daniel hires the web's most offensive attorney, plays the most disturbing game of pin the tail on the donkey ever seen, and dog trapped in man's body gets a web redemption.

    Tosh.0 - Model Teacher (Season 6 - Episode 6)

    Daniel makes the audience drink something he made from a toilet; overpriced headphones; a teacher gets a Web redemption.

    Tosh.0 - Prancing Elites (Season 6 - Episode 7)

    Daniel rids the world of homophobia with the Prancing Elites; turns your horrific tweets into a book for children; touches one lucky fan emotionally.

    Tosh.0 - Comedian Daniel Songer (Season 6 - Episode 8)

    Daniel shows why you should never take your girlfriend to a ball game; a 49-year-old up-and-coming comic gets a Web redemption.

    Tosh.0 - Missed Every Layup (Season 6 - Episode 9)

    Daniel sees how much citrus the human eye can withstand; a man is taught how to play basketball.

    Tosh.0 - Roof Jump (Season 6 - Episode 10)

    Daniel makes the hashtag game more interesting; chats with the happiest and creepiest guy in Los Angeles; a girl who wants the internet to pay for her injuries gets a Web redemption.

    Tosh.0 - Spoken Word Fail (Season 6 - Episode 11)

    Daniel helps a religious rapper reclaim his throne; Daniel explains why there's no such thing as stupid questions (just stupid girls); smokes pot.

    Tosh.0 - Banned From Walmart (Season 6 - Episode 12)

    Daniel throws shoes at women; Daniel's intimate conversations get leaked to the press; the cheapest man in America gets a Web redemption.

    Tosh.0 - Nana Nana Subaru Winner (Season 6 - Episode 13)

    Daniel reveals who will get his old Subaru; shows why it's never safe to pass out at his home.

    Tosh.0 - Space Shuttle Launch (Season 6 - Episode 14)

    Daniel buries shovel girl; fans dispense "Twisdom" to the class of 2014; a guy who lost the space race gets a web redemption.

    Tosh.0 - Perfect Game Bowler (Season 6 - Episode 15)

    Daniel webchats with a goat, and a bowler who got screwed out of a perfect game gets a web redemption.

    Tosh.0 - Summertime is Great (Season 6 - Episode 16)

    Daniel celebrates the end of vacation by redeeming an embarrassing family; Daniel goes all out on some bail jumpers; Daniel reveals his most erotic wardrobe to date.

    Tosh.0 - Lingerie Football Coach (Season 6 - Episode 17)

    Daniel meets the only man in the world who cares about women's sports; a cutter in the office; a celebration of the return of Is It Racist?

    Tosh.0 - Bryan Silva (GRATATA) (Season 6 - Episode 18)

    A couple gets handsy at their local McDonald's, Daniel hangs out with Bryan Silva on his yachtata, and Tosh.0's male fans send in nude photos of themselves.

    Tosh.0 - Dog Trainer (Season 6 - Episode 19)

    Brooklyn's baddest dog expert gets a Web Redemption; Daniel offers up some life hacks; "Tosh.0" enjoys the last barbecue of the summer.

    Tosh.0 - Dumped by Sweetheart (Season 6 - Episode 20)

    A heartbroken teenager gets a Web Redemption; a master of seduction gives advice on how to have a threesome; Daniel pulls spills the secret on his pre-show ritual.

    Tosh.0 - Weightlifting (Season 6 - Episode 21)

    The world’s worst weightlifters get a Web Redemption, Daniel plays a round of Is It Racist?, and Tosh.0 fans destroy their property.

    Tosh.0 - The Family Friendly Episode (Season 6 - Episode 22)

    Daniel becomes a big brother for a day and invites kids to ask him questions. A rocking horse bucks its rider, and a little girl proves to have a very strong grip.

    Tosh.0 - Redneck Rappers (Season 6 - Episode 23)

    Two barely literate rappers try to rhyme; football coach Lane Kiffin fails again; Daniel explores the sensual side of escalators.

    Tosh.0 - Where Are They Now (Again)? (Season 6 - Episode 24)

    From the absolutely absurd to the incredibly ingenious, the series features viral clips, sketches, and "Web Redemptions" which give subjects of infamous viral videos a second chance to redeem themselves from the embarrassment with which they've become synonymous.

    Tosh.0 - Kayak (Season 6 - Episode 25)

    Andy Kindler rants about fall TV, a redhead loses control of his kayak, and Daniel's fans try to scare him on Twitter.

    Tosh.0 - Date Camp (Season 6 - Episode 26)

    Daniel works with some intimacy coaches; Daniel calls for an end to disrespecting women.

    Tosh.0 - Gay Restaurant (Season 6 - Episode 27)

    A gay couple banned from a homophobic restaurant gets a Web redemption; a "Tosh.0" rip-off gets exposed; Daniel learns the true meaning of irony.

    Tosh.0 - Wheel of Fortune (Season 6 - Episode 28)

    Daniel channels his inner game show host; Daniel makes up a musical; Daniel exposes a government cover-up with global implications.

    Tosh.0 - Black Santa (Season 6 - Episode 29)

    Daniel celebrates Christmas; the reveal of who shot Black Santa; the most extreme Nana Nana Boo Boo yet; a secret Tosh family holiday recipe.

    Tosh.0 - Best of Season 6 (Season 6 - Episode 30)

    A look back at the moments that made 2014 horrible; future trippin' with Doug Stanhope; a trashy engagement party is crashed.
